After researching the net and calling Crutchfield for an adapter to use an aftermarket receiver, I decided to take matters into my own hands. Nothing was available. And, now I have an Alpine 7897 receiver running my mids/tweets >200hz and the factory amps are running the four subs <200hz. So, it is possible to wire up the factory amps to any receiver.
